3步构建抖音内容自动化采集流水线

张开发
2026/4/7 9:42:14 15 分钟阅读

分享文章

3步构建抖音内容自动化采集流水线
3步构建抖音内容自动化采集流水线【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具去水印支持视频、图集、合集、音乐(原声)。免费免费免费项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ader你是否还在手动复制粘贴抖音链接每次下载都要处理水印、整理文件传统方式不仅耗时耗力更难以应对批量内容采集需求。今天介绍的这款开源工具将帮你打造一套完整的抖音内容自动化采集流水线。问题场景内容采集的三大痛点当你需要收集竞品视频、分析行业趋势或建立内容库时总会遇到这些瓶颈手动下载效率低下批量处理无从下手下载的文件杂乱无章后续整理耗时耗力平台限制频繁变动技术门槛越来越高。效率对比传统方式下载100个视频需要一整天而自动化工具仅需30分钟。这不仅是时间节省更是工作模式的彻底变革。解决方案从采集到管理的全链路设计douyin-downloader采用模块化设计将复杂的内容采集拆解为清晰的工作流。它像智能流水线一样自动完成链接解析、内容获取、数据处理和文件存储四个关键环节。核心优势支持无水印视频、高清图集、原声音乐的一站式下载并自动按作者-日期-作品的结构化方式存储。抖音下载工具命令行参数界面清晰展示各种下载选项和配置参数工具提供双版本策略V1.0稳定版适合单视频下载V2.0增强版专为用户主页批量下载优化。这种设计让你在不同场景下都能获得最佳体验。实操指南快速部署与配置环境准备与安装首先克隆项目仓库git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ader然后进入项目目录安装依赖。关键步骤是配置Cookie认证这是访问抖音内容的前提条件。# 安装依赖 pip install -r requirements.txt # 自动获取Cookie推荐 python cookie_extractor.py基础下载操作对于单视频下载使用V1.0版本最为稳定。编辑config.yml配置文件后直接运行即可。而对于用户主页的批量采集V2.0版本提供了更强大的功能。# 下载用户主页所有作品 python downloader.py -u https://www.douyin.com/user/xxxxx # 自动Cookie管理批量下载 python downloader.py --auto-cookie -u https://www.douyin.com/user/xxxxx参数调优技巧合理配置参数能显著提升下载效率。--music/-m控制是否下载原声音乐--cover/-c决定是否保存视频封面--avatar/-a则管理作者头像的下载。根据你的实际需求灵活组合这些参数。批量下载进度界面实时显示每个视频的下载状态和完成情况扩展应用行业场景深度整合竞品分析与市场研究市场团队可以设置定时任务自动采集竞品账号的最新内容。通过分析下载的视频、封面和音乐洞察行业趋势和用户偏好变化。这种数据驱动的方法比传统问卷调研更真实、更及时。内容库建设与知识管理教育机构或媒体公司可以建立系统化的内容库。工具自动创建的结构化文件夹让内容管理变得简单按作者分类、按日期排序、按作品主题命名。搜索特定内容时再也不需要翻遍整个硬盘。直播内容存档与分析对于需要监控直播活动的团队直播下载功能提供了实时录制能力。支持多种清晰度选择确保录制质量满足后续分析需求。无论是活动复盘还是内容二次创作都能获得高质量的源素材。下载后的文件组织结构按作者和日期分类存储便于内容管理和查找技术原理像快递分拣系统一样工作工具的核心原理类似于现代快递分拣系统。链接解析模块识别内容类型和来源内容获取模块通过API接口提取原始资源数据处理模块进行去水印和格式优化最后存储模块按预设规则分类存放。无水印技术直接访问抖音API获取原始视频流绕过平台的水印添加机制。这保证了下载内容的纯净度避免了传统录屏带来的质量损失。并发下载机制采用多线程技术像快递分拣线的多个工位同时工作。通过配置文件调整线程数量在最大化下载效率的同时避免触发平台限制。性能调优与问题排查常见问题解决方案如果遇到下载失败首先检查网络连接和Cookie状态。Cookie过期是最常见的问题运行python cookie_extractor.py重新获取即可。对于批量下载中的个别失败工具会自动重试并跳过已成功下载的文件。性能优化建议根据你的网络环境和硬件配置调整并发数。普通家庭网络建议设置为3-5个线程企业专线可提升到8-10个。如果下载大量高清视频适当增加超时时间设置避免因网络波动导致的中断。直播下载命令行界面展示直播间识别和清晰度选择功能存储空间管理定期清理不需要的临时文件特别是下载过程中产生的缓存。建议为不同项目创建独立的下载目录便于后续的归档和备份。对于长期存储的内容可以考虑压缩归档以节省空间。进阶功能定制你的采集流水线脚本自动化集成结合Python脚本和任务调度器你可以实现完全自动化的采集流程。设置定时任务在特定时间自动下载目标账号的最新内容。这种自动化不仅节省时间还能确保数据的及时性和完整性。数据预处理管道下载的内容可以直接接入数据分析工具。通过简单的脚本处理提取视频元数据、分析封面设计趋势、统计音乐使用偏好。这为后续的内容分析和决策提供了丰富的数据基础。质量监控与报警建立简单的监控机制当下载失败率超过阈值时自动发送通知。这让你能及时发现问题并干预确保采集流程的稳定运行。对于关键账号的内容采集这种监控尤为重要。总结开启高效内容管理新时代douyin-downloader不仅仅是一个下载工具更是内容工作流的智能中枢。它将繁琐的手动操作转化为自动化流程将杂乱的文件管理转化为结构化存储将技术门槛转化为简单配置。无论你是个人创作者、市场研究员还是企业团队这款工具都能显著提升你的工作效率。从今天开始告别手动下载的烦恼拥抱智能化的内容采集与管理。【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具去水印支持视频、图集、合集、音乐(原声)。免费免费免费项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章